Solution

The correct option is C 40
If the number of students making the lanterns increases, then the time required will decrease.

This is a case of inverse proportion.

Initially, 20 students took 60 minutes to make 40 lanterns. Now, there are 20 + 10 = 30 students.

Using the formula for inverse proportion,
No. of students× Time reqd (in mins) = constant
20 × 60 = 30 × Time reqd (in mins)
Time required (in mins) = 20×6030=40
